#46d242 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46d242 is composed of 27.5% red, 82.4%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 118.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 54.1%. #46d242 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cff84 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#46d242 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#46d242 has RGB values of R:70, G:210,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4641346.

Shades and Tints of #46d242

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#46d242

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#829381 is the less saturated color, while #1bff15 is the most saturated one.
